About

Drag queen who earned the title the Queen of Disco with the songs "Dance (Disco Heat)" and "You Make Me Feel (Mighty Right)."

Before Fame

He spent much of the 1960s homeless until graduating from Jordan High School in 1969.

Trivia

He had his highest charting album with the #7 R&B album Step II.

Family Life

He was in a relationship with Rick Cranmer at the time of his death.

Associated With

He featured Herbie Hancock on his 1981 single "Magic Number."
